What Are The Ingredients For Protein-enriched French Toast (Eating for Life) Recipe?

The ingredients for Protein-enriched French Toast (Eating for Life) are:

1/2 cup egg substitute
1 scoop or 3 TBS vanilla protein powder (I use Muscle-10)
1/4 tsp ground cinnamon
2 slices whole wheat bread
1/4 cup sugar-free maple syrup



How Do I Make Protein-enriched French Toast (Eating for Life)?

Here is how you make Protein-enriched French Toast (Eating for Life):

Lightly coat a non-stick skillet with cooking spray and place over medium hear. In a bowl, pour in egg substitute, protein powder and cinnamon. Stir until smooth (batter will be thick). Dip bread into batter and let soak up the mixture for 10 seconds. Turn bread over and repeat. Place batter soaked bread onto skillet and cook 2 to 3 minutes on each side until golden brown. Serve and enjoy :)Serving Size: Makes 1 serving (two pieces of French Toast)Number of Servings: 1Recipe submitted by SparkPeople user CPRZYBYLA.


What's The Nutritional Info For Protein-enriched French Toast (Eating for Life)?

The nutritional information for Protein-enriched French Toast (Eating for Life) is:

  • Servings Per Recipe: 1
  • Amount Per Serving
  • Calories: 299.4
  • Total Fat: 2.1 g
  • Cholesterol: 1.3 mg
  • Sodium: 747.4 mg
  • Total Carbs: 39.2 g
  • Dietary Fiber: 4.9 g
  • Protein: 33.1 g
